什么是混合云?

作者:JC2025.10.12 01:30浏览量:2

简介:混合云作为云计算的核心模式之一,通过整合公有云与私有云资源,为企业提供灵活、安全且成本优化的IT解决方案。本文从架构、优势、应用场景及实施建议四个维度解析混合云,助力企业高效部署。

什么是混合云?——企业IT架构的“弹性桥梁”

一、混合云的定义与核心架构

混合云(Hybrid Cloud)是一种将公有云(如AWS、Azure、阿里云)与私有云(自建数据中心或托管云)通过技术手段(如VPN、专线、API)无缝集成的云计算模式。其核心目标是通过资源池化实现按需分配:将非敏感业务(如Web应用、测试环境)部署在公有云以降低成本,将核心数据(如用户信息、财务系统)保留在私有云以确保安全

架构关键组件

  1. 统一管理平台:通过Kubernetes、OpenStack等工具实现跨云资源调度。例如,使用K8s的Federation功能可同时管理多个集群的Pod分布。
  2. 数据同步层:采用ETL工具(如Apache NiFi)或数据库中间件(如MySQL Group Replication)实现跨云数据一致性。
  3. 安全网关:部署IPSec VPN或SD-WAN技术保障跨云通信加密,例如通过AWS Transit Gateway连接本地数据中心与VPC。

二、混合云的四大核心优势

1. 成本与性能的平衡术

  • 按需扩展:电商大促期间,可将突发流量导向公有云,避免私有云硬件闲置。例如,某零售企业通过AWS Auto Scaling在“双11”期间动态扩容服务器,成本降低40%。
  • 资源优化:将开发测试环境迁移至公有云,按分钟计费,相比私有云长期运维节省60%以上成本。

2. 安全合规的双重保障

  • 数据隔离:金融行业可通过私有云存储交易数据,公有云处理用户交互,满足《网络安全法》对数据本地化的要求。
  • 灾备能力:混合云架构支持“双活”部署,如某银行将核心系统同步至阿里云,实现RTO<1分钟、RPO=0的灾备标准。

3. 业务创新的加速器

  • AI/大数据实验场:利用公有云的GPU集群训练模型,私有云部署推理服务。例如,医疗企业通过腾讯云TI平台训练影像识别模型,私有化部署至医院内网。
  • 全球化服务:跨国企业可通过混合云实现就近访问,如某游戏公司在中国私有云部署游戏服务器,在海外公有云节点部署CDN,降低延迟30%。

4. 渐进式迁移的平滑路径

  • 混合部署:传统企业可先迁移非核心系统(如OA、邮件)至公有云,逐步验证后再迁移核心业务。例如,某制造企业通过华为云Stack实现ERP系统与公有云的无缝对接。

三、典型应用场景与代码实践

场景1:跨云数据备份与恢复

  1. # 使用AWS Boto3实现S3到本地私有云的备份
  2. import boto3
  3. import os
  4. s3 = boto3.client('s3')
  5. local_path = '/data/backup/'
  6. def backup_to_private_cloud(bucket_name, key):
  7. # 下载S3文件
  8. s3.download_file(bucket_name, key, os.path.join(local_path, key))
  9. # 通过SCP传输至私有云(需提前配置SSH密钥)
  10. os.system(f'scp {local_path}{key} user@private-cloud:/backup/')

场景2:Kubernetes多云调度

  1. # 通过K8s Federation实现跨云Pod部署
  2. apiVersion: multicluster.k8s.io/v1alpha1
  3. kind: FederatedDeployment
  4. metadata:
  5. name: cross-cloud-app
  6. spec:
  7. template:
  8. metadata:
  9. labels:
  10. app: cross-cloud
  11. spec:
  12. containers:
  13. - name: nginx
  14. image: nginx:latest
  15. placement:
  16. clusters:
  17. - name: aws-cluster
  18. - name: private-cluster

四、实施混合云的五大建议

  1. 评估业务需求:明确数据敏感性、合规要求及扩展预期,避免“为混而混”。例如,初创企业可优先选择公有云,成熟企业再引入私有云。
  2. 选择兼容技术栈:确保公有云与私有云支持相同容器平台(如K8s)、存储协议(如iSCSI)和API标准。
  3. 建立跨云监控体系:使用Prometheus+Grafana集成公有云(如AWS CloudWatch)与私有云指标,实现统一告警。
  4. 规划网络拓扑:采用SD-WAN替代传统MPLS,降低跨云延迟。例如,某企业通过VeloCloud将跨云延迟从50ms降至20ms。
  5. 制定迁移路线图:分阶段迁移,先验证IaaS层(计算、存储),再迁移PaaS层(数据库、中间件),最后迁移SaaS应用。

五、未来趋势:混合云的智能化演进

随着AI与边缘计算的融合,混合云将向智能混合云升级:

  • AI驱动的资源调度:通过机器学习预测流量峰值,自动调整公有云与私有云资源配比。
  • 边缘混合云:在工厂、医院等边缘场景部署轻量级私有云,与中心公有云协同处理实时数据。例如,某车企通过混合云架构实现车载T-Box数据在边缘私有云预处理,关键数据上传至公有云训练自动驾驶模型。

混合云不仅是技术架构的升级,更是企业数字化转型的战略选择。通过合理规划与实施,企业可在安全、成本与效率之间找到最佳平衡点,为未来业务创新奠定坚实基础。